News: Battlefield Hardline players will be getting some new content next month with new maps, weapons, vehicles and more.



”Battlefield

Battlefield Hardline is getting some new content according to EA. You’ve assembled a crew, pulled off the perfect heist and made a whirlwind escape from the police. Now, there are enemies lurking in the frozen shadows, dark figures hiding behind crumbling mausoleums, and confrontations brewing in back alleys and federal prisons. Beginning next month Battlefield Hardline: Betrayal brings with it some new maps, weapons, vehicles and more. If you purchase this new content (or have the season pass) you will receive the following:

  • Four intricate maps - Alcatraz, Cemetery, Chinatown and Thin Ice

  • Seven new weapons

  • Two new vehicles

  • Customize primary weapons and uniforms with the Gun Bench Super Feature, and test them at the Gun Range

  • New Assignments and Legendary weapon camos


  • In addition to all of that, you will receive a base game update that includes eleven new weapons and new server presets. After the update, every Gold Battlepack you open may also contain a weapon license voucher –a Distinguished class item that unlocks an entire weapon license.
